BECOMING SUSAN is a portrait documentary about Toronto activist Susan Gapka. The film enters Susan’s world through an exploration of the spaces around her, with Susan’s story filling these personal spaces before her visual representation does. BECOMING SUSAN presents a way of sharing the world of a trans-woman without focusing on the physical. Instead, visual fragments of Susan and her world serve as powerful metaphor for Susan’s journey from pieces to a whole. As we explore each new piece presented by the documentary we begin to understand that each is as important as the last to understanding her. Multi-faceted and complex Susan is, as we all are, made up of fragments of each moment of life.
